Geoffrey Ryan jailed  21 August 2013 
A man armed with a knife who threw a smoke device into an Islamic centre in Essex has been jailed for nine months.
Geoffrey Ryan, 43, turned up at Al Falah prayer centre in Braintree on 22 May, about five hours after soldier Lee Rigby's death in Woolwich.
Ryan, of Brick Kiln Way, Braintree, admitted affray and two counts of possessing an offensive weapon at Chelmsford Crown Court.No one was hurt in the attack in Silks Way.

 Lee Rigby murder trial: Conspiracy charge dropped against alleged Woolwich killers

A charge of conspiracy to murder a police officer has been dropped against the alleged killers of Woolwich soldier Lee Rigby.
An Old Bailey jury has been told that Michael Adebolajo, 29, and Michael Adebowale, 22, will no longer be tried on this count.
However, they still face charges of murder and attempted murder of a police officer, which they both deny.
Both men are accused of running Fusilier Rigby, 25, down in a car and then hacking him to death with a meat cleaver and knives near Woolwich barracks in south-east London on May 22.
Jurors at the Old Bailey were told by Mr Justice Sweeney they were discharged from any further consideration of a count of conspiracy to murder a police officer.
However, the jury was also warned by Mr Sweeney that nothing said by Adebolajo in his evidence amounts to a legitimate defence in law against the charge of murder.
He said: ‘I have ruled that nothing said by the first defendant and … his evidence – in short he was a soldier of Allah and was justified in doing what he did – amounts in law to a defence to this count.
‘So nothing that he has said amounts in law to a defence to count one.’
